Background
Village under the old system
Konoha was the leading village among the Five Great Ninja Villages and operated within the One Country, One Village System established by the First Hokage. Under that arrangement, the Daimyo held political and economic power while the village supplied military force. 1 129
The village entered a weakened period after the Nine-Tails Attack: Minato and Kushina died, many jonin were lost, Orochimaru had defected, and Jiraiya and Tsunade were absent. The later destruction of Root further depleted Konoha's strength. 34 58
Namikaze Mirai's administration
Namikaze Mirai became Konoha's Fifth Hokage after the war with Kumogakure, succeeding Sarutobi Hiruzen. His inauguration was publicly celebrated by villagers and strongly supported by the Uchiha clan. 83 85
Mirai redirected Konoha away from dependence on missions and Daimyo funding by developing industry, medical commerce, agricultural production, and military technology. 88 139
Republic of Fire
Konoha abolished the One Country, One Village System, killed the Land of Fire's Daimyo, and absorbed the former ruling structure's authority. The Land of Fire became the Republic of Fire, with Konoha as its capital and its sole political and military power; the former capital was redesignated as a commercial hub. 129 139
The Republic subsequently announced the Fire Federation, offering protection to countries that overthrew their Daimyo and adopted a new political system. 139 140
Ninja Alliance
Following the Fourth Great Ninja War, Konoha brought the Five Great Nations under its control. The old Daimyo-and-nobility order collapsed as the remaining nations merged into the Republic of Fire. 212 213
Mirai then established the Ninja Alliance as a federation intended to unify the Ninja World's resources and defenses against the Otsutsuki clan. By this period, Konoha led a unified world in which the era of independent major ninja villages had ended. 213 255

Economy and development
Hybrid rice
Yamato cultivated hybrid rice under Mirai's direction, creating a variety expected to significantly increase crop yields. Konoha used the achievement to establish the Agricultural Production Cooperative and enter the grain market. 102
The Land of Fire's resulting harvest was large enough to supply an estimated 70% of the Ninja World's population, making Konoha central to regional food security. 120
Medical and humanitarian influence
Umbrella Medical Company exported medicine that, while inferior to Konoha's internal products, still exceeded most medicine available elsewhere. This gave Konoha a foothold in markets across the Ninja World. 149
The Red Cross Aid Society extended Konoha's influence through refugee assistance, though rival villages often viewed the program as political expansion rather than humanitarian work. 90 121
Regional engineering
Konoha used the Hidden Rain Village's water resources to support the Land of Wind. Mirai personally broke terrain barriers to create a waterway, enabling irrigation and the development of new oases around Sunagakure. 178
Defense and technology
Uchiha Peacekeeping Force
The Peacekeeping Force was built around the Uchiha clan's combat ability and deterrent value. Its members were equipped with advanced ninja blades, tracking-and-communication badges, and other research-derived equipment. 106 167
- Commander: Uchiha Shisui. 106
- International role: Pursued rogue ninja, intervened in foreign crises, and protected states aligned with Konoha's new system. 145 160
- Heavenly Eye Network: Reconnaissance drones could upload information for rapid identification of enemies, including their identities, abilities, and backgrounds. 167
Modern warfare forces
Konoha replaced much of traditional ninja warfare with firearms, reconnaissance systems, missiles, and mechanized weapons. 71 198 199
- Hyuga Sniper Unit — Combined Byakugan reconnaissance with firearms to ambush enemy formations at long range. 131
- Drones and artillery — Used against the Shinobi Alliance alongside sniper fire and missile barrages. 198 199
- Gundams — Deployed during the Fourth Great Ninja War; Sasori's Unit-01 was among the machines that overwhelmed the alliance's forces. 178 199
- Sword of Damocles — An airborne fortress armed with an energy beam powerful enough to destroy Hidden Cloud Village. 207
- Nuclear weaponry — Mirai's nuclear explosion in the southeastern waters of the Land of Water became the decisive deterrent that compelled Hidden Stone Village to surrender. 212
